Logic Fixer
Diagnosis without repair is incomplete. This skill takes broken reasoning and produces a corrected version — one where the premises actually support the conclusion, the hidden assumptions are made explicit, the fallacies are removed, and the argument can be defended.
The output is not a critique. It is a fixed version of what you were trying to say.
Your Process
Step 1: Diagnose before repairing Don't jump to a fix. First, be specific about what's broken:
- What type of failure is this? (Invalid inference / unsupported premise / logical fallacy / internal contradiction / hidden assumption doing too much work / overclaimed conclusion)
- Where exactly does the reasoning break — at which step?
- What is the argument trying to establish? (Separate the intent from the execution — the intent might be sound even if the argument isn't.)

Step 2: Classify the repair needed Different failure modes need different repairs:
| Failure | Repair |
|---|---|
| Unsupported premise | Add evidence, or qualify the premise |
| Overclaimed conclusion | Narrow the conclusion to what the premises actually support |
| Missing step | Make the implicit inference explicit |
| Circular reasoning | Identify the begged question; provide independent support for the conclusion |
| False dichotomy | Reframe to acknowledge the full option space |
| Invalid inference | Add the bridging premise that makes the inference valid |
| Equivocation | Disambiguate the term; use different words for different senses |
| Hidden assumption | Surface it as an explicit premise; assess whether it holds |
